Psalm 34:21
“Evil shall slay the wicked: and they that hate the righteous shall be desolate.”
KJV
Read in Psalm 34Meaning
Evil brings the wicked to ruin and those who hate the righteous are held guilty; this moral warning is not a simple karma formula for predicting each person’s earthly outcome.
Affliction, preservation, and redemption
Verses 19–22 acknowledge many afflictions, divine preservation, moral consequence, and the LORD’s redemption of servants who take refuge in him.
